Try downloading the file again to see if it completes successfully. Download manager. For users who commonly encounter intermittent connectivity issues or download failure, a download manager may help. A download managers is a third-party application that monitors, and if needed, resumes a download from where it stopped previously. As a site owner, you can help secure data by setting the Offline Client Availability setting to ' No'. On the site, click Settings Site Settings. Under Search, click Search and offline availability. In the Offline Client Availability section, select 'No'. To allow users to download content with the sync client, set the Offline Client.
